At 15:13 on 30 Dec 2024, I placed a bet with Bet365, Echuca 1/1 the
next day, 31 Dec, $54 @ 8.50 Place (cut back to MBL, I just ask for
$200 on all bets, let their computer do the arithmetic).
Early next morning, prior to 9am, I tried to place a bet on the same
horse and was correctly rejected. I'd not recorded the bet, and make
so many I'd forgotten, so hit the Live Chat, thinking they had a
software bug, and asked why the bet was rejected. He said wait a
while, he'll check.
In the meanwhile I looked at my "Unsettled Bets", and saw yesterday's,
so before he came back, sent a message "My apologies, I've just seen
in the list of Unsettled Bets that I backed it yesterday (drunk?).
Again, sorry to have needlessly bothered you". 

The (drunk?) was a joke, it was Christmas - New Year after all. But
I'd spent the day at home, and don't drink at home other than maybe
when I have visitor(s) 

But Bet365 applied "certain restrictions" to my account, specifically
rejecting all bets on anything, purportedly on the basis that my
throwaway "(drunk?)" indicated I was a problem gambler and needed
Aunty 365 to help me. A women went through a series of ridiculous
questions - Do I get excited when I win? (I don't even watch the
races) Do I feel stressed if I don't bet? Does losing upset me? Does
losing effect others? Do I have a need to bet?........... Said she'd
call me "tomorrow" after examining my prior history. Today, 13 days
later, she rang, saying she was not satisfied that I should be allowed
to bet, but offered me self-exclusion for 6 months, after which I
could resume betting. And kept it up - would I like to spend time
considering, give her my answer tomorrow ....

	20+ years ago, a female Judge of the Family Court wrote in her
Reasons "Mr Loveday's gambling is not a problem. On the contrary it 
has enabled the standard of living the family has enjoyed". Should I
pass that onto Bet365, appeal to the NTRC, see a lawyer...? Just use
bowlers, reverting to the way it was before MBL?
